  • Patent number: 11245739
    Abstract: Future data connection quality may be predicted based on past data connection quality, and future requests for data may be predicted based on past requests. These predictions may be used to help decide whether, when, and/or how to deliver the data in a proactive manner. For example, according to some aspects described herein, a future data connection quality may be predicted based at least on historical data connection quality. It may be determined whether to pre-deliver at least a first portion of an item of content based at least on the predicted future data connection quality. If so, then the at least the portion of the item of content may be pre-delivered to the device and/or to another destination.

  • Patent number: 11228925
    Abstract: Aspects of the disclosure are directed toward intelligently selecting the operating parameters of wireless access points (WAPs) deployed in a wireless environment so as to minimize or at least reduce interference in that wireless environment. A WAP continually measures the characteristics of the wireless channels used in the wireless environment and obtains measurements of channel metrics for those channels. The WAP stores the channel metric measurements as a channel metric history and analyzes the channel metric history to determine correlations between the channel metric measurements and various timeframes. The WAP selects one or more of its operating parameters based on the channel metric history and the correlations identified. Operating parameters include the radio frequency band and channel to transmit on.

  • Patent number: 11228629
    Abstract: Methods and systems for intelligent use of off-peak bandwidth are disclosed. An example method can comprise receiving a request for content from a user device. The content server can transmit the content to the user device. Upon receiving a teardown command to suspend transmission of the content, after transmitting a first portion of the content to the user device, the content server can determine that playback of the content is likely to be resumed at a peak time. The content server can then pre-position a second portion of the content proximate to the user device prior to the peak time.
